These listings focus on non-electric hardware that integrates with standard toilet seats. The designs emphasize slim profiles and self-cleaning nozzle systems.
These models are built for DIY setup in under 5 minutes. They attach directly to the existing toilet seat hardware.
The catalog includes both black and white finishes. This allows for better visual matching with different bathroom fixtures.
The dual nozzle systems include a self-cleaning function. This ensures the spray heads remain hygienic between uses.
These units require no batteries or wall outlets. They rely entirely on the home water pressure for operation.
